Yosemite Mountain Sugar Pine Railroad is a historic railroad that still operates two steam train locomotives. Once used for lugging timber out of a logging operation managed by Madera Sugar Pine Lumber Company, the railroad is now used for providing unforgettable scenic adventures.

Today, the railroad offers daily train rides from mid-March through late October. The train leaves at 11:00 a.m., with other departure times added during the busy season. Tickets can be purchased online or at the Depot Ticket Office.

After purchasing tickets, visitors will hop aboard the historic Logger Steam Train and take a seat in either the open-air or covered passenger car. The train will then lead you on a scenic four-mile excursion through the beautiful forest landscape.

You’ll even stop briefly at Lewis Creek Canyon where you can stretch your legs and get an up-close look at the locomotive before heading back. All in all, the ride lasts about one hour, but you may just find yourself wishing it was longer!

The train ride isn’t the only exciting thing waiting for you at Sugar Pine Railroad. Here, you’ll be completely immersed in the charm of the iconic California Gold Rush. Visitors can even pan for gold in authentic sluice boxes.

Besides the Yosemite Mountain Sugar Pine Railroad, are there other train excursions in Northern California that you want to learn more about? In short, yes, there are quite a few different train excursions in NorCal that vary in the ride and the activities on board. For instance, the Sierra Railroad Dinner Train offers themed dinners that feature live music and local breweries. Meanwhile, the Napa Valley Wine Train lets you travel through scenic Napa Valley as you sip delicious glasses of wine. You can also climb aboard the world-famous Skunk Train in Willits, California, which has run through the beautiful redwood forests since 1885.
